Robot Code Generator: Pantheon Robotics Demo
Pantheon Robotics' demo showcases a groundbreaking web application that generates executable robot code directly from natural language descriptions. This innovative tool leverages the power of GPT-4 and the Vercel AI SDK to translate your instructions into functional code for a generic robot, mirroring the capabilities of their physical proof-of-concept robot—a car. The application simplifies the process of programming robots, eliminating the need for complex coding knowledge.
Key Features
- Natural Language Input: Describe the desired robot actions in plain English.
- Code Generation: The app automatically translates your instructions into executable code.
- Generic Robot Model: The code is designed for a generic car-like robot, reflecting Pantheon Robotics' physical prototype.
- Ease of Use: No prior programming experience is required.
- AI-Powered: Utilizes the advanced capabilities of GPT-4 and the Vercel AI SDK.
How it Works
- Describe the Task: Clearly articulate what you want the robot to do. For example, you might say, "Drive forward 10 meters, then turn left 90 degrees." Remember, the robot is a car, so commands should be appropriate for a vehicle.
- Generate Code: Click the 'Generate code now!' button.
- Review and Execute: The app will display the generated code. You can then execute this code on a compatible robot platform.
Use Cases
- Rapid Prototyping: Quickly test and iterate on robot behaviors without extensive coding.
- Educational Tool: Learn about robotics and programming in an accessible and engaging way.
- Simplified Automation: Automate simple tasks for a car-like robot.
Limitations
- Car-like Robot: The generated code is specific to a car-like robot; it cannot handle actions requiring arms or flight.
- Complexity: Extremely complex tasks may require more detailed instructions or may not be fully supported.
Comparison to Other Tools
Unlike traditional robotics programming environments that require extensive coding knowledge, Pantheon Robotics' demo offers a user-friendly interface accessible to a wider audience. It streamlines the process of creating robot control programs, making it a valuable tool for both experienced roboticists and beginners.
Conclusion
Pantheon Robotics' demo represents a significant step towards making robotics more accessible. By leveraging the power of AI, this tool simplifies the process of robot programming, opening up new possibilities for automation and innovation. The intuitive interface and powerful AI capabilities make it a valuable asset for anyone interested in exploring the world of robotics.